Why RepOS exists

A new rep should never cost you a surgeon.

When a rep leaves, their knowledge leaves too. The new rep walks in blind, faults the surgeon once — sometimes that's all it takes.

We've watched it happen. The company doesn't lose a case — it loses the surgeon, and hundreds of thousands to millions with them.

RepOS makes that knowledge transferable. The next rep walks in already knowing.

Security & compliance

Built for a regulated room.

No PHI, by design

RepOS runs on cases, preferences, and equipment — not patients. No patient identifiers, ever. The report excludes them on purpose.

Locked down today

Face ID sign-in. Auto-lock when idle. Data on your device. Credentials in the iOS Keychain — not web storage.

The compliance track

Team accounts ship with encryption at rest and in transit, audit logging, SSO & SAML, and BAAs — the full HIPAA-readiness path for company deployments.

Straight answer: RepOS is not a system of record for protected health information today, and won't claim compliance before it's earned. Companies evaluating team deployment — talk to us about the timeline.
